Montgomery County, Missouri[edit | edit source]

Montgomery County is a county located in the eastern part of the U.S. state of Missouri. As of the 2010 census, the population was 12,236. Its county seat is Montgomery City. The county was named in honor of Richard Montgomery, an American Revolutionary War general killed in 1775 while attempting to capture Quebec City, Canada.

Healthcare in Montgomery County, MO[edit | edit source]

Healthcare in Montgomery County, Missouri is provided by a variety of institutions, ranging from large hospitals to individual healthcare providers. The county is home to several healthcare facilities that provide a wide range of services to the residents.

Hospitals[edit | edit source]

  • SSM Health St. Mary's Hospital - Audrain is a 89-bed facility offering a range of services including emergency care, cardiology services, medical imaging, men's health services, women's health services, and home health services. It is located in nearby Audrain County, but serves many Montgomery County residents.
  • Hermann Area District Hospital is a critical access hospital located in Hermann, MO. It provides emergency care, surgical services, and has a specialty clinic. It is about 30 miles from Montgomery City, making it a viable option for many residents.

Healthcare Providers[edit | edit source]

  • SSM Health Medical Group has a location in Montgomery City. They offer primary care services, including family medicine and internal medicine.
  • Missouri Cancer Associates is a leading provider of cancer care in Missouri and has a location in nearby Mexico, MO. They offer a full range of services, including medical oncology, radiation oncology, and hematology.

Public Health[edit | edit source]

  • The Montgomery County Health Department provides a variety of public health services to the residents of Montgomery County. These services include immunizations, health education, vital records, and environmental health services.
